Transaction 85f9253f59beb256f33ee34581b06381fd406d0b70399d89797a1b25c90340c7
1 Input
1 Output
-
85f9253f59beb256f33ee34581b06381fd406d0b70399d89797a1b25c90340c7:0
- value
- 78068659
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5dc6d5511bf0f9cb86990a510bfefa60a23f35e
- address
- bc1qchwx64g3hu8eewrfjzj3p0l05c9z8u670ydhfl